What is a pediatric optometrist?

Pediatric optometrists focus on the eye health and vision development of infants, children, and adolescents.

When to see one: For your child's eye exams, vision screening, or development concerns.

Before your appointment

  • Confirm Pharris's license is active and unrestricted with the Colorado board (link on this page).
  • Ask whether the visit is a routine exam or a medical eye evaluation, and what it covers.
  • Bring your current glasses or contacts, plus a list of medications and any family history of eye disease.
  • Ask about cost, insurance, and whether dilation or extra imaging carries a separate fee.
  • Mention symptoms like dryness, headaches, or screen strain so they can be addressed during the exam.
